Get in Touch** The Volkswagen repair market in the Pittston area is characterized by a clear distinction between general repair shops and dedicated European specialists. While there are numerous generic mechanics, the demand for specialized knowledge for VW's TSI, TDI, and DSG systems has fostered a competitive niche market. The top-tier specialists, like those listed above, compete on expertise, diagnostic capability, and access to specialized tools (like VCDS) rather than price. * **Average Quality:** The quality of service is bifurcated. General shops may offer lower prices but often lack the specific training and tools for complex VW systems, leading to potential misdiagnoses. The specialized shops provide a significantly higher quality of service, justifying their higher labor rates. * **Competition Level:** Competition among the top European specialists is strong but professional. Each has cultivated a slightly different reputation (e.g., German Auto Masters for performance, Faust for long-term reliability), allowing them to coexist by serving slightly different customer priorities. * **Typical Pricing:** Labor rates for these specialists typically range from **$120 - $150 per hour**, which is above the area average for general repair but competitive with, and often more cost-effective than, the local VW dealership. Complex jobs like a DSG service can cost $400-$600, while turbocharger replacements are typically $2,000+ in parts and labor. **Important Note on Electric Vehicle (ID.4) Service:** For the ID.4 and other electric vehicles, the service ecosystem is still developing. For high-voltage system repairs and warranty work, owners are almost always directed to the **Kelly Volkswagen of Wilkes-Barre** dealership. The independent specialists listed are excellent for non-high-voltage components (brakes, suspension, 12V systems) but may not yet be equipped for full EV powertrain service.

In Pittston, we frequently address issues related to the harsher winter climate, such as problems with the electrical system (including sensors and window regulators) exacerbated by road salt and moisture. We also commonly service diesel particulate filters (DPF) on TDI models due to shorter, stop-and-go driving common in the area, which prevents proper regeneration cycles.
Look for a shop with Volkswagen-specific diagnostic tools (like VCDS/VAG-COM) and certified technicians familiar with VW's engineering. In Pittston, seek out shops with strong local reputations, often found through community recommendations in Luzerne County or verified online reviews that mention successful repairs on models like the Golf, Jetta, or Atlas.
You should seek diagnosis immediately, as a delayed response can lead to more costly repairs, especially with VW's complex emissions systems. Given the area's temperature swings and potholed roads, the light could indicate anything from a loose gas cap to a critical sensor failure, so prompt, professional scanning is crucial.
Yes, Volkswagen repairs can be moderately higher due to the need for specialized parts and proprietary technology. However, a trusted local independent shop will often provide significant savings over a dealership, sourcing quality parts while offering expertise on VW models commonly driven in Northeastern Pennsylvania.
Pittston's winters with road salt and summer potholes demand vigilant maintenance. We recommend more frequent undercarriage washes to combat rust and earlier tire and suspension component inspections to address wear from rough roads, adhering to the "severe service" schedule in your VW's manual.
